Stephen Winsten was born on February 6, 1935 in New York City, NY, USA. He was a cinematographer and writer, known for Scratch Harry (1969), The Drifter (1966) and Martian Space Party (1972). He died on September 14, 2010 in Gansevoort, New York, USA.
